boolevalHeader-only C++17 library for evaluating logical expressions.
Stars: ✭ 54 (+145.45%)
ExprExpression language for Go
Stars: ✭ 2,123 (+9550%)
color-mathExpressions to manipulate colors.
Stars: ✭ 18 (-18.18%)
ExpressionevaluatorA Simple Math and Pseudo C# Expression Evaluator in One C# File. Can also execute small C# like scripts
Stars: ✭ 194 (+781.82%)
eslumpFuzz testing JavaScript parsers and suchlike programs.
Stars: ✭ 56 (+154.55%)
evaluatorNo description or website provided.
Stars: ✭ 35 (+59.09%)
BBob⚡️Blazing-fast js-bbcode-parser, bbcode js, that transforms and parses to AST with plugin support in pure javascript, no dependencies
Stars: ✭ 133 (+504.55%)
esvalidconfirm that a SpiderMonkey format AST represents an ECMAScript program
Stars: ✭ 24 (+9.09%)
EscodegenECMAScript code generator
Stars: ✭ 2,328 (+10481.82%)
Formula ParserParsing and evaluating mathematical formulas given as strings.
Stars: ✭ 62 (+181.82%)
astutilsBare essentials for building abstract syntax trees, and skeleton classes for PLY lexers and parsers.
Stars: ✭ 13 (-40.91%)
ParserA lexer and parser for GraphQL in .NET
Stars: ✭ 163 (+640.91%)
react-multi-contextManage multiple React 16 contexts with a single component.
Stars: ✭ 19 (-13.64%)
texprBoolean evaluation and digital calculation expression engine for GO
Stars: ✭ 18 (-18.18%)
Astevalminimalistic evaluator of python expression using ast module
Stars: ✭ 116 (+427.27%)
Math EngineMathematical expression parsing and calculation engine library. 数学表达式解析计算引擎库
Stars: ✭ 123 (+459.09%)
astravel👟 Tiny and fast ESTree-compliant AST walker and modifier.
Stars: ✭ 38 (+72.73%)
EstreeThe ESTree Spec
Stars: ✭ 3,867 (+17477.27%)
pascal-interpreterA simple interpreter for a large subset of Pascal language written for educational purposes
Stars: ✭ 21 (-4.55%)
SwiftpascalinterpreterSimple Swift interpreter for the Pascal language inspired by the Let’s Build A Simple Interpreter article series.
Stars: ✭ 270 (+1127.27%)
Parse Code ContextParse code context in a single line of javascript, for functions, variable declarations, methods, prototype properties, prototype methods etc.
Stars: ✭ 7 (-68.18%)
Libpypalibpypa is a Python parser implemented in pure C++
Stars: ✭ 172 (+681.82%)
Parse Comments Parse JavaScript code comments. Works with block and line comments, and should work with CSS, LESS, SASS, or any language with the same comment formats.
Stars: ✭ 53 (+140.91%)
Snapdragonsnapdragon is an extremely pluggable, powerful and easy-to-use parser-renderer factory.
Stars: ✭ 180 (+718.18%)
liltLILT: noun, A characteristic rising and falling of the voice when speaking; a pleasant gentle accent.
Stars: ✭ 18 (-18.18%)
Bash ParserParses bash into an AST
Stars: ✭ 151 (+586.36%)
parse-function(!! moved to tunnckoCore/opensource multi-package repository !!) 🔱 Parse a function into an object using espree, acorn or babylon parsers. Extensible through Smart Plugins.
Stars: ✭ 37 (+68.18%)
ctxexp-parserIn the dynamic execution of JS language environment (wechat applet) to execute JS class calling function.
Stars: ✭ 17 (-22.73%)
jsevalEvaluate JavaScript on a URL through headless Chrome browser.
Stars: ✭ 19 (-13.64%)
gogoASTThe simplest tool to parse/transform/generate code on ast
Stars: ✭ 29 (+31.82%)
asmdot[Unstable] Fast, zero-copy and lightweight (Arm | Mips | x86) assembler in (C | C++ | C# | Go | Haskell | Javascript | Nim | OCaml | Python | Rust).
Stars: ✭ 23 (+4.55%)
decimal-evalA tiny, safe, fast JavaScript library for decimal arithmetic expressions.
Stars: ✭ 18 (-18.18%)
Micromarkthe smallest commonmark compliant markdown parser that exists; new basis for @unifiedjs (hundreds of projects w/ billions of downloads for dealing w/ content)
Stars: ✭ 793 (+3504.55%)
Metric Parser📜 AST-based advanced mathematical parser written by Typescript.
Stars: ✭ 26 (+18.18%)
BabylonPSA: moved into babel/babel as @babel/parser -->
Stars: ✭ 1,692 (+7590.91%)
EsprimaECMAScript parsing infrastructure for multipurpose analysis
Stars: ✭ 6,391 (+28950%)
Eval Expression.netC# Eval Expression | Evaluate, Compile, and Execute C# code and expression at runtime.
Stars: ✭ 271 (+1131.82%)
Eval Sql.netSQL Eval Function | Dynamically Evaluate Expression in SQL Server using C# Syntax
Stars: ✭ 84 (+281.82%)
Script.apexEvaluate Javascript expressions in Apex
Stars: ✭ 18 (-18.18%)
angular-expression-parserThis library helps in achieving AngularJs equivalents of $parse, $eval and $watch in Angular.
Stars: ✭ 17 (-22.73%)
GovaluateArbitrary expression evaluation for golang
Stars: ✭ 2,130 (+9581.82%)
PySODEvalToolkitPySODEvalToolkit: A Python-based Evaluation Toolbox for Salient Object Detection and Camouflaged Object Detection
Stars: ✭ 59 (+168.18%)
katawAn 100% spec compliant ES2022 JavaScript toolchain
Stars: ✭ 303 (+1277.27%)
parse-commit-message(!! moved to tunnckoCore/opensource !! try `parse-commit-message@canary`) Parse, stringify or validate a commit messages that follows Conventional Commits Specification
Stars: ✭ 31 (+40.91%)
gitsumparse and summarise git repository history
Stars: ✭ 43 (+95.45%)
marc4jsA Node.js API for handling MARC
Stars: ✭ 35 (+59.09%)
reactube-clientA clone Youtube Web Player using React Provider Pattern, React Context and Typescript
Stars: ✭ 92 (+318.18%)
react-native-web-viewAn implementation of React Native's WebView that allows for postMessage on iOS devices.
Stars: ✭ 13 (-40.91%)
der-parserBER/DER parser written in pure Rust. Fast, zero-copy, safe.
Stars: ✭ 73 (+231.82%)
ninny-jsonJSON typeclasses that know the difference between null and absent fields
Stars: ✭ 19 (-13.64%)
vscode-blockmanVSCode extension to highlight nested code blocks
Stars: ✭ 233 (+959.09%)
retidyExtract, unminify, and beautify ("retidy") each file from a webpack/parcel bundle (JavaScript reverse engineering)
Stars: ✭ 27 (+22.73%)
use-app-state🌏 useAppState() hook. that global version of setState() built on Context.
Stars: ✭ 65 (+195.45%)
pumaMeta-programming framework for JavaScript based on LayerD concepts
Stars: ✭ 30 (+36.36%)
no-redux⚛️ 🎣 Experimenting with using hooks and context instead of Redux
Stars: ✭ 79 (+259.09%)